Hardware Kyocera Torque
System chip:
Qualcomm Snapdragon S4 Plus MSM8960
Processor :
1024 MB RAM (Dual-channel, 500 MHz) / LPDDR2 / 4096 MB ROM
Storage expansion:
microSD, microSDHC up to 32 GB
Battery Kyocera Torque
Talk time:
18.00 hours
the average is 11 h (675 min)
Capacity:
2500 mAh
Type:
Li - Ion

 Realme 15 Pro with 7000 mAh battery declassified before announcement

Shortly before the premiere of a new series of smartphones company realme published several official teasers of the model realme 15 Pro. Images declassified part of the technical specifications and design of the future novelty, and insiders, in turn, leaked into the network a few of its real photos.

 Lenovo has released a magnetic cooler for mobile gaming devices

Lenovo has expanded its portfolio of branded accessories by releasing the Legion cooler with a magnetic mount. The novelty is positioned as a universal solution for a range of gaming Android devices, including the brand's latest gaming tablet.

 The low-cost vivo Y19s GT gets a 90-Hertz screen and MIL-STD 810H protection

The company vivo has released a budget smartphone Y19s GT 5G, one of the main features of which is a rugged body with military standard certification. In addition, the device is equipped with a high-capacity battery and a 50-megapixel main camera.
